What Is the Ideal Playgroup Age?
Most early childhood educators agree that 2 to 3 years is the ideal window for playgroup.
At this stage, children typically:
- Begin speaking small words and sentences
- Show curiosity about other kids
- Can walk, run, and explore safely
- Start understanding simple instructions
- Are ready for short separation from parents

Signs Your Child Is Ready for Playgroup

- Curiosity – Your child explores new places and toys.
- Basic Communication – They can express needs with words or gestures.
- Short Independence – They can stay with a caregiver for some time.
- Interest in Other Kids – They observe or try to play alongside peers.
- Energy for Activities – They enjoy drawing, stacking blocks, music, or movement.
If you notice most of these, it may be the right age to start play school for your child.
What Children Actually Learn in Playgroup
Parents often ask what happens inside a playgroup classroom. It’s not formal academics. Instead, children learn through:
- Rhymes, music, and storytelling
- Coloring, clay, puzzles, and blocks
- Circle time and group play
- Outdoor play for strength and balance
- Habit formation (tidying up, waiting turns)
- Early exposure to sounds, shapes, and colors

Playgroup vs Nursery: Understanding the Age Difference
A common confusion is nursery vs playgroup age.
| Program | Typical Age | Focus |
|---|---|---|
| Playgroup | 2–3 years | Social, emotional, motor skills through play |
| Nursery | 3–4 years | Introduction to phonics, numbers, structured activities |

Why Starting Too Early Can Be Difficult
Admitting a child before they turn 2 can lead to:
- Separation anxiety
- Difficulty following routines
- Frequent crying and discomfort
- Health issues due to low immunity

Why Starting Too Late Is Also Not Ideal
Delaying beyond 3.5 years may cause:
- Difficulty adjusting to group settings
- Slower social development compared to peers
- Hesitation in communication
- Challenges when entering nursery directly
This is why timing matters.

Common Parent Concerns (Answered)
“My child cries when I leave. Should I wait?”
Crying is normal in the first days. With patient teachers, children settle soon.
“My child doesn’t speak clearly yet.”
Playgroup actually improves speech through songs and interaction.
“Is playgroup necessary?”
It’s not compulsory, but it greatly helps children adjust before formal schooling.

The Role of Parents During the Transition
Parents can make the start smoother by:
- Talking positively about school
- Visiting the campus before admission
- Maintaining a goodbye routine
- Avoiding long emotional farewells
- Trusting the teachers
Children sense parental confidence.
